Grab & Go Kids Planner: Family Night at Farmers' Market, Ladybug Release and More

Here's your weekly roundup of kid-friendly events in the Tri-Valley for Wednesday through Sunday.

Looking for something fun to do with the kids this week?

Our weekly Grab & Go calendar focuses on five kid-friendly events in the Tri-Valley. And we've added an out-of-town outing for an easy weekend getaway.

Pick and choose from this week’s array of events: Amgen Tour of California in Livermore, "Family Night" at Farmers' Market in Dublin, Into the Woods play in San Ramon, 4th Annual Ladybug Release in Pleasanton and a family bike ride and bike fit expo in Danville.

Family Best Bets of the Week


  • Where/When:
    Downtown Livermore on Wednesday morning
    Why Go:
    Livermore will be the start city for Stage 4 of the Amgen Tour of California, America's largest cycling event. Festivities begin downtown about 9 a.m. and the race starts at 11:45 a.m. on the corner of First and L streets. for more details.
    Price: Free

  • Where/When: in Dublin on Thursday from 4 - 8 p.m.
    Why Go: Family Night is the theme of this week's Farmers' Market, which will feature face painting, "mom and me" craft activities, Valley Children's Mobile Museum tours and other family-friendly activities.
    Price: Free

    • Where/When:
      in San Ramon on Friday, Saturday and Sunday
      Why Go:
      See what happens when fairytale characters—Rapunzel, Little Red Riding Hood, vengeful giants, a wicked witch and many others—come together in Into the Woods. The popular musical premiered on Broadway in 1987 and earned several Tony Awards. The whole family will enjoy this production by the San Ramon Community Theater now through May 28.
      Price:
      $13 - 16. Click here to order tickets.

    • Where/When:
      on Saturday in Pleasanton at 2 p.m.
      Why Go:
      Kids can learn all about ladybugs, finding out how these cute creatures keep gardens healthy and safe. Participants will release ladybugs at the park and then take some home for their own gardens. This event requires advance registration.
      Price:
      $9 for residents and $12 for non-residents. Click here to register.


    • Where/When:
      and other locations in Danville on Sunday from 11:30 a.m. - 4 p.m. (Click event link above for location lists and schedule.)
      Why Go:
      Celebrate National Bike Month with Sustainable Danville Area and enjoy a family-friendly bicycle ride along the Iron Horse Trail and a free Bike Fit Expo. for full details.
      Price:
      Free

    Need a quick getaway? Here’s this week’s pick: The Bay Area's Maker Faire at San Mateo County Event Center showcases invention and creativity in the areas of science, technology, engineering, food, arts and crafts. The two-day family-friendly festival runs Saturday from 10 a.m. - 8 p.m. and Sunday from 10 a.m. - 6 p.m. Ticket prices range from $10 for a single day youth pass to $50 for a two-day adult weekend pass.
